1. Plum blossoms are less white than snow, but snow is less fragrant than plum blossoms.
——Lu Meipo's "Snow Plum Part One"
Translation: The plum blossoms make the snowflakes crystal clear and white, but the snowflakes lose the fragrance of the plum blossoms!
2. If you want to see a thousand miles away, reach a higher level.
——Wang Zhihuan's "Climbing the Stork Tower"
Translation: If you want to see enough of the scenery thousands of miles away, you have to climb to a higher tower!
3. If you don’t climb a high mountain, you don’t know how high the sky is; if you don’t go to a deep stream, you don’t know how deep the earth is; if you don’t listen to the last words of the past kings, you don’t know how great knowledge is.
——Xun Kuang's "Xunzi Encouraging Learning"
